Russian officers and state media downplayed President Joe Biden’s shock go to to Ukraine on Monday, portray Kyiv as a U.S. puppet and sustaining Moscow’s forces will prevail regardless of Washington’s pledges to ship extra weapons to Ukraine.

Biden met with President Volodymyr Zelenskyy within the Ukrainian capital in a defiant show of Western solidarity with a rustic nonetheless preventing what he known as “a brutal and unjust war” days earlier than the one-year anniversary of Russia’s invasion.

The go to additionally got here on the eve of Russian President Vladimir Putin’s scheduled state-of-the-nation deal with, which some in Russia count on to set the tone for the 12 months forward _ together with for Putin’s bogged-down marketing campaign in Ukraine.

Biden spent greater than 5 hours in Kyiv, consulting with Zelenskyy on subsequent steps, honoring the nation’s fallen troopers and seeing U.S. embassy workers.

He introduced an extra half-billion {dollars} in U.S. help – on prime of the greater than $50 billion already offered – for shells for howitzers, anti-tank missiles, air surveillance radars and different support however no new superior weaponry.

Russian state tv lined the go to extensively, with anchors saying that it was clear that Biden “runs things” in Ukraine, which inserts into the Kremlin’s narrative that Zelesnkyy’s authorities is a stooge of the U.S. administration.

A Russian-installed official within the occupied Zaporizhzhia area, Vladimir Rogov, was quoted by Russia’s state news RIA Novosti news company as saying that Zelenskyy “looked like a servant next to Biden.”

Other commentators famous that Biden may search re-election in 2024 and mentioned his go to to Kyiv kicked off his marketing campaign.

“Biden in Kyiv started his election campaign in the most heroic surroundings in order to prove to everyone that he can still `do it just like in the good old days’,” senior Russian lawmaker Konstantin Kosachev mentioned in a Telegram publish, including that “Kyiv was left with no choice by to try and drive people to the senseless slaughter as part of Biden’s election campaign.”

Pro-Kremlin pundits on state TV additionally alleged that Biden obtained safety ensures from Moscow forward of the go to. U.S. nationwide safety adviser Jake Sullivan mentioned that the U.S. authorities notified Moscow of Biden’s go to to Kyiv shortly earlier than his departure from Washington “for deconfliction purposes” in an effort to keep away from any miscalculation that would deliver the 2 nuclear-armed nations into direct battle.

“Everyone knows that if Russia said that it wouldn’t hit Kyiv during a visit of some statesmen there, it means this will never happen, because we are the ones who keep their word, those who are on the side of the good and the civilized,” pro-Kremlin political analyst Sergei Markov mentioned in a political speak present on state Russia 1 TV channel.

The deputy head of Russia’s Security Council and former president, Dmitry Medvedev, in a publish on the Telegram messaging app additionally claimed that Biden had obtained “safety guarantees.”

Medvedev mentioned Biden “pledged allegiance to the neo-Nazi regime” _ as Kremlin officers consult with Ukraine’s authorities _ and promised it extra weapons, however the thousands and thousands of individuals leaving Ukraine present a solution “to the question of who the future belongs to.”

And state TV journalist Andrei Medvedev in a Telegram publish merely said: “Will this visit influence the final outcome of the war? No. Absolutely not,” though admitting that it could affect “the course of the hostilities at the moment and morale of Ukrainian citizens.”

Political analyst Tatyana Stanovaya mentioned the Kremlin will view Biden’s go to as “yet one more piece of evidence that the U.S. has completely bet on Russia’s strategic defeat in the war, and that the war itself has irrevocably turned into a war between Russia and the West.”

Stanovaya mentioned Putin’s state-of-the-nation speech on Tuesday “was expected to be very hawkish, aimed at defiantly breaking off relations with the West,” however after Biden’s go to to Kyiv, “additional edits can be made to make it even harsher.”
